Restricted: Managers Only — Halverin JV Proposal

Summary for the incoming director: the proposed joint venture with Skarholt Marine would combine our Driftline sensors with their hull platforms, split sixty-forty in our favour. Diligence is complete; board vote pending. Governance terms are settled except the exit clause. The key sensitivity is noted below.

board note of bawep-tajef: Queniusek Systems plans to raise the Quenvan list price by 53.1 percent in March. The pricing group signed off on a budget of $176.4 million for Project Drueth. The renewal with Casionix Partners closes at $142.5 million a year, 8.3 percent below the last contract. Project Fraax slips by six weeks because of the tooling delay.

## Runbook: FeedCheck Validator Stalls

If the podcast feed validator queue backs up, first confirm the fetcher workers are alive and that upstream feeds aren't timing out en masse. Restart workers one at a time to preserve in-flight validations. Before restarting, capture the current queue depth for the incident log. Then confirm the service is running with these values.

deployment values, kajep-kageg:
[praix]
host = praix.paliqcorp.corp
user = praix_svc
database = praix_prod

The Orvane Labs bike cage and the east and west parking gates operate on separate access schedules, and facilities desk staff should note that visitor vehicles may only use the west gate between 07:00 and 19:00. Cyclists requesting cage access must show a valid day pass, and their details should be entered in the access ledger before the cage is opened. Gates must never be propped open, even briefly, during deliveries. When a manual override is required at either gate, use the code below.

staff pass of fadup-fawig = bdg-FUNKS-4

## Artifact Signing for Blue-Green Deploys

The Lumberjack billing worker ships via blue-green rotation on the Fernwheel platform. Plugin authors must sign every artifact before the green slot accepts it; unsigned bundles are rejected at admission, not at runtime, so failures surface early. Verify your manifest hash matches the build output exactly. All green-slot promotions for Lumberjack are validated against the key below.

deploy key for yagef-bafof: bky13_7XSsjPzjdWU3k